Eugene Police arrests 48-year-old woman on 46 counts of animal neglect

The Eugene Police Department reports that it has arrested 48-year-old Alyse Ninnette Edmonson on 46 counts of Animal Neglect. According to EPD, Animal Services responded to a call for service about a vacated apartment with at least 17 cats and abandoned kittens on August 21, 2023.

Authorities say that the tenant, 48-year-old Alyse Ninnette Edmonson, had turned in her keys earlier that day. EPD alleges that some of the cats appeared malnourished and needed veterinary care.

Animal Services reportedly found the apartment covered in feces and urine with no food or water present. Some of the cats were taken to the Greenhill Humane Society while others were transported to Feline Good.

EPD says there were 46 cats in total. Animal Services investigated the abandonment and neglect. A warrant was issued for Edmonson. On October 16, Edmondson was arrested at an apartment in the 1600 block of Olive Street.

She was booked on 46 counts of Animal Neglect in the Second Degree. Authorities say they’re searching for 42-year-old Daniel James Thellman who is wanted for Anima Neglect. EPD urges anyone with information to call Animal Services at 541-682-5748.
